Beyonce is on Apple Fitness+ Artist Spotlight series. The Beyoncé-inspired exercises will be accessible through the Fitness app. The app will feature seven specifically tailored cycling, dancing, HIIT, pilates, strength, treadmill, and yoga workouts that will use her music. Peloton has announced that they are teaming up with Beyoncé to create slew of themed workouts over their cycling app that include cycling, running, bootcamp, yoga, meditation and strength.
